Understanding the Research Basis of Magtein's Mental Enhancement
Magtein, or magnesium L-threonate, stands apart from other magnesium salts due to its unique method of action and subsequent brain effects. Traditional magnesium is often poorly absorbed, largely staying in the body’s tissues. However, the threonate molecule acts as a vehicle, facilitating the efficient transport of magnesium across the blood-brain barrier. This is essential because it allows magnesium to directly influence neuronal function within the central nervous system. Studies have indicated that Magtein can improve synaptic density – the connections between neurons – which is linked with enhanced memory and learning capabilities. Furthermore, it appears to modulate levels of brain-derived neurotrophic factor (BDNF), a protein crucial for neuronal growth, survival, and plasticity - the mind's ability to evolve. The precise pathways are still being investigated, but the research suggests a profound and targeted influence on mental performance.
